City Guide

Dankama, Katsina, Nigeria

Overview

Dankama is a small, lively town in Katsina State, Nigeria, known for its busy local markets and warm community atmosphere. The town provides an authentic look into daily life in rural northern Nigeria and is a commercial hub for surrounding villages.

Best Time to Visit

November to February for cooler, dry-season weather.

Local Tips

Carry cash in small denominations, as card payment is uncommon. Early mornings are best for market visits and intercity transport connections.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ially around religious sites. Tipping is not expected but appreciated in local eateries. Greet elders respectfully and ask permission before photographing people.

Safety Warnings

Stay alert in crowded markets for petty theft. Avoid traveling alone after dark and be cautious near remote outskirts. Consult local advice for up-to-date security information.

Hidden Gems

Visit the weekly livestock market for a unique cultural experience and enjoy local Hausa snacks from roadside stalls at dawn.
